I never thought a sandwich would make my top spot when it comes to my favourite takeaway but wow. Even just thinking about the salt beef brisket which is cured for days, the home made meat balls in marinara sauce and the micro bakery baked bread. Even the sauces and condiments are home made. I don’t even normally like pickle and especially not ones made out of cauliflower and other vegetables for sure, but that was bang on too. Yes, I headed to Bramley to try Silver’s Deli.
I do think like jacket potatoes we’re going to see a spike in sandwiches because you can’t beat a butty - and there’s no VAT on it. Leeds has several epic sarnie spots I’d recommend: Slips Deli on Cardigan Road is absolutely banging and knocks out some cracking food. I tried the breakfast sub and Italian Job wrap with homemade sauce and meatballs. It wasn’t swimming in grease. I’ve got to say it’s one of the nicest breakfast butties.
